UK Visa-Sponsored Registered Nurse Jobs (£31,200 per year)
People all over the world regard the UK’s healthcare system for its high standards, cutting-edge medical technology, and dedication to patient care. Registered nurses are crucial for providing a wide range of services, from emergency hospital treatment to community health and long-term care for the elderly.
Visa-sponsored jobs give international nurses the chance to work in a wide range of places, from busy city hospitals in London to quiet rural clinics in Scotland. They also help a system that serves millions of people.

Benefits of UK Visa-Sponsored Registered Nurse Jobs
- First of all, you will get competitive pay, as well as overtime, bonuses, and shift differentials.
- Second, you will get free or discounted visa processing, which covers the cost of applying for a visa, flying, and getting a Certificate of Sponsorship (COS).
- You might be able to apply for Indefinite Leave to Remain (ILR) after working nonstop for five years. This will make you a UK citizen.
- Furthermore, you will be able to get free NHS health care, dental care, and contributions to your pension.
- There are also opportunities to move up in your work and keep learning (CPD).
- Some employers may give free or low-cost housing, transportation, and help with settling in.
